Khasan Khalmurzaev
Khasan Magometovich Khalmurzaev is a Russian judoka. Khasan won the gold medal in the Judo at the [2016 Summer Olympics – Men's 81 kg|–81 kg] event at the 2016 Summer Olympics.
At the 2017 World Judo Championships, Khalmurzaev lost the fight to Alexander Wieczerzak in the semifinals, but won the third-place match against Otgonbaataryn Uuganbaatar.
Personal life
Khalmurzaev has a twin brother, Khusen, who is a judoka, too. He also has three older sisters and an older brother. Their father died when Khasan was 14 years old.Khalmurzaev serves in the separate battalion of the Patrol-Guard Service of the Ministry of Internal Affairs in Ingueshetia. He is a police sergeant.
Khasan married Zalina in Nasyr-Kort, Ingushetia, on 17 September 2017.
Awards
- Order of Friendship — for high sports achievements at the 21st Summer Olympics in 2016 in Rio de Janeiro, for his will for victory and sense of purpose.
- Medal "For Service Virtue"
